Our editorial standard.
Clear principles help us stay useful when the technology and the news cycle move quickly.
Source first
We prefer original announcements, documentation, direct statements and primary evidence wherever they are available.
Context over noise
Speed matters, but a fast article still needs to explain why the development matters and what remains uncertain.
Opinion with evidence
We separate reported facts from analysis and make strong judgments only when the available evidence supports them.
Readers before algorithms
Headlines should earn attention without misrepresenting the story. Useful structure matters more than empty search-engine filler.
Transparent relationships
Affiliate links, review units and sponsored work are disclosed where relevant. Commercial support does not purchase editorial conclusions.
Human responsibility
AI tools may support parts of the workflow, but published content remains subject to editorial review and human responsibility.
Clarity includes accountability.
If a factual error is identified, we review reliable supporting evidence and correct the article where appropriate.
Testing context, product changes and personal use cases matter. A recommendation is editorial judgment, not a universal guarantee.
Relevant affiliate, advertising and partnership relationships are explained without making them visually stronger than the story.
